Magic Stun Heat in Double OT Thriller, Dash Miami's Playoff Hopes

National Desk
April 26, 2026
ORLANDO, Fla. -- The Orlando Magic ignited Amway Center with a stunning double-overtime victory over the rival Miami Heat on Saturday night, winning 136-130 in a game that swung wildly between Sunshine State foes. Evan Fournier led Orlando with 26 points, including the dagger 3-pointer that put the Magic ahead for good late in the second overtime. The win keeps Orlando 3.5 games behind the Chicago Bulls for the final play-in spot with 14 games remaining, injecting life into their season.[1][2] Miami, clinging to playoff hopes, couldn't hold off Orlando's relentless comeback in the heated intrastate rivalry dating back decades. The Heat–Magic battles have produced iconic moments, from the Magic's franchise-record 25-point rally earlier this season to their 117-108 triumph over Miami in the 2025 NBA Cup quarterfinals led by Desmond Bane's 37 points.[3] Saturday's clash added another chapter, with Orlando outlasting a gritty Heat squad fighting for every possession in front of roaring Florida fans. For Miami, the loss stings amid a tight Eastern Conference race, forcing the Heat to regroup quickly with the regular season winding down. Orlando's depth shone through, building on recent heroics like Cole Anthony's 13-point fourth-quarter explosion in a prior 121-114 comeback win over Miami. As both teams eye the postseason, this double-OT epic underscores Florida's fierce NBA pride, with the Magic now carrying momentum into the stretch run.[1][2][3]
